Volunteers of Hindu Munnani on Monday blocked traffic on the Kottakuppam Road protesting against a liquor shop situated near a temple in Muthialpet.

The volunteers led by Hindu Munnani state president Sunilkumar said that liquor shops in residential areas were a big nuisance. As per rules, a liquor shop cannot be set up close to religious places and schools.

Sentiments hurt

The presence of this shop has hurt the sentiments of people and it should be removed soon, he said. Police officials rushed to the spot and pacified them following which they withdrew their protest.
